Q: What are the main components of an x-ray machine? A: The main components include the x-ray tube, control panel, collimator, image receptor, and protective housing, all working together to produce diagnostic images. Q: How should an x-ray machine be maintained? A: Regular inspection, calibration, and cleaning are essential to keep the x-ray machine operating accurately and safely over time. Q: What industries use x-ray machines besides healthcare? A: X-ray machines are also used in security screening, industrial testing, and materials inspection to identify defects or hidden items. Q: Why is calibration important for an x-ray machine? A: Calibration ensures that the machine delivers accurate radiation doses and consistent image quality, which is crucial for reliable diagnostics. Q: How long does an x-ray machine typically last? A: With proper maintenance, an x-ray machine can remain operational for over a decade, depending on usage frequency and environmental conditions.
